Question 11 Mark
Power set of the set A = {1, 2} is ______________.
Answer
Power set of the set A = {1, 2} is $\big\{\{1\},\{2\},\{1,2\},\phi\}$.
Solution:
Power set of $\text{A}=\text{p(A)}=\big\{\{1\},\{2\},\{1,2\},\phi\big\}.$
Hence, the filler is $\big\{\{1\},\{2\},\{1,2\},\phi\}.$

Question 21 Mark
When $\text{A}=\phi,$ then number of elements in P(A) is ______________.
Answer
When $\text{A}=\phi,$ then number of elements in P(A) is 1.
Solution:
Here $\text{A}=\phi \therefore \text{n(A)}=0$
$\because \text{n}[\text{P(A)}]=2^{\text{n(A)}}=2^0=1$
Hence, the filler is 1.

Question 41 Mark
If A and B are finite sets such that $\text{A}\subset\text{B},$ then $\text{n} (\text{A} \cup \text{B})$ = ______________.
Answer
If A and B are finite sets such that $\text{A}\subset\text{B}$ then $\text{n}(\text{A}\cup\text{B})=\text{n(B)}.$
Solution:
Since $\text{A}\subset\text{B}\therefore \text{n}(\text{A}\cup\text{B})=\text{n(B)}$
Hence, the filler is n(B).

Question 61 Mark
For all sets A and B, $\text{A} - (\text{A} \cap \text{B})$ is equal to ______________.
Answer
For all sets A and B, $\text{A} - (\text{A} \cap \text{B})$ is equal to $\text{A}\cap\text{B}'.$
Solution:
Since $\text{A}-\text{B}=\text{A}\cap\text{B}'$
$\Rightarrow \text{A}-(\text{A}\cap\text{B})=\text{A}\cap\text{B}'$

Hence, the filler is $\text{A}\cap\text{B}'.$

Question 71 Mark
If U = {1, 2, 3, 4, 5, 6, 7, 8, 9, 10}, A = {1, 2, 3, 5}, B = {2, 4, 6, 7} and C = {2, 3, 4, 8}. Then
  1. $(\text{B} \cup \text{C})'$ is ______________.
  2. (C - A)' is ______________.
Answer
If U = {1, 2, 3, 4, 5, 6, 7, 8, 9, 10}, A = {1, 2, 3, 5}, B = {2, 4, 6, 7} and C = {2, 3, 4, 8}. Then
  1. $(\text{B} \cup \text{C})'$ is {1, 5, 9, 10}.
  2. (C – A)' is 1, 2, 3, 5, 6, 7, 9, 10}.
Solution:
Given that: U = {1, 2, 3, 4, 5, 6, 7, 8, 9, 10},
A = {1, 2, 3, 5}, B = {2, 4, 6, 7} and C = {2, 3, 4, 8}
  1. $(\text{B}\cup\text{C})'=\{2,3,4,6,7,8\}'=\{1,5,9,10\}$

Hence, the filler is {1, 5, 9, 10}.

  1. $(\text{C}-\text{A})'=\{4,8\}'=\{1,2,3,5,6,7,9,10\}$

Hence, the filler is {1, 2, 3, 5, 6, 7, 9, 10}.
